EU court limits YouTube's intermediary defense over reviewed content

The European Court of Justice has ruled that YouTube can no longer claim intermediary status for content it has actively reviewed. This decision means YouTube may be held more directly responsible for copyright infringements or other violations on its platform, particularly concerning content it has vetted or approved. AI
